WebApr 17, 2003 · When a physician or group practice bills in the name of a nurse practitioner and uses his or her Medicare billing number, payment will be made at the lower of 80 percent of the actual charge or 85 percent of the physician fee schedule amount. Services and supplies furnished “incident to” the services of nurse practitioners may also be ... WebNov 2, 2024 · Incident to billing is paid at 100% of the physician fee schedule, whereas the qualified practitioners billing under their own billing numbers are paid at 85% of the physician fee schedule. WebNov 10, 2024 · Medicare payment is made at 100 percent when billed under the physician’s name as opposed to 85 percent if billed under the name of a PA or NP. In … WebPAs and NPs can bill under their own names and receive 85 percent of the Medicare physician fee schedule (MPFS) rate. Physicians often work with NPPs on an incident-to basis.

WebDec 1, 2024 · The NPI is a 10-position, intelligence-free numeric identifier (10-digit number). This means that the numbers do not carry other information about healthcare providers, such as the state in which they live or their medical specialty. The NPI must be used in lieu of legacy provider identifiers in the HIPAA standards transactions.
